Immigration Forms |
Request for Certification of Military
or Naval Service
Purpose of Form:
This form is used by an applicant for
naturalization to request that the Department
of Defense verify the applicant's military or naval service.
Number of Pages:
7
Edition Date:
6/30/06. Prior versions
acceptable.
Where to File:
Return
the form to the office which requested the certification.
Filing
Fee:
$0.00
Special
Instructions:
Pages 1, 3 and 5 of the form are identical and are to be
filled out by the applicant. Pages 2, 4 and 6 are to be
filled out by a certifying officer of the Department of
Defense.
If relevant, please see (M-599), Naturalization Information
for Military Personnel (or the text version).
